Information

BirthFeb 1877 Mamie Murphy was born in Feb 1877 in Indiana. 
1880 Census
(with Parents)
2 Jun 1880 Mamie appeared in the 1880 Federal Census of Jackson Township, Cass County, Indiana, as Mivana Murphy, in the household of her parents, Cornelia and William Murphy. She is a single white female, age 3. Daughter of head of household. Her occupation is at home. She was born in Indiana. Her father was born in Ohio, her mother in Indiana. 
1900 Census
(with Parents)
15 Jun 1900 Mamie appeared in the 1900 Federal Census of Arapahoe Precinct, Fumas County, Nebraska, as Mamie Murphy, in the household of her parents, Cornelia and William Murphy. She is a single white female, age 23. Daughter of head of household. Born February 1877 in Indiana. her father was born in Ohio, her mother in Indiana. Her occupation is helping at home. She can read, write and speak English. 
Marriageabout 1904 Mamie Murphy and William C. Samson were married about 1904. 
1910 Census
(Spouse of Head)
6 May 1910 Mamie appeared in the 1910 Federal Census of Arapahoe Precinct, Fumas County, Nebraska, with her husband, William C. Samson. Their son, Clark, was listed as living with them. 
1920 Census
(Spouse of Head)
31 Jan 1920 Mamie appeared in the 1920 Federal Census of Arapahoe Precinct, Fumas County, Nebraska, as Mariam Samson, with her husband, William C. Samson. Their son, Clark, was listed as living with them. 
1930 Census
(Spouse of Head)
23 Apr 1930 Mamie appeared in the 1930 Federal Census of Arapahoe Precinct, Fumas County, Nebraska, with her husband, William C. Samson
1940 Census
9 Apr 1940 Mamie appeared in the 1940 Federal Census of Lincoln, Lancaster County, Nebraska, in the household of Holly and Clark B. Samson
